Termite protection works best as a routine of prevention, inspection, and fast action rather than a one-time product purchase. Most damaging termite activity happens out of sight, inside wall voids, beneath floors, or behind exterior finishes. Homeowners can lower the risk by keeping wood away from soil, correcting moisture problems, maintaining clear inspection access around the foundation, and arranging a professional assessment when warning signs appear. If termites are already present, prevention alone is no longer enough; the treatment method should match the termite species, construction type, and location of the activity.

What termite protection should accomplish

Effective termite protection has two jobs: make the property less inviting and identify active termites before they cause extensive hidden damage. The first job is largely maintenance. The second requires deliberate observation, because termites often consume wood from the inside and leave a thin outer surface that can look normal until it is pressed, tapped, or opened.

A good plan does not assume every property faces the same risk. Homes with crawl spaces, wood siding near grade, attached decks, poor drainage, plumbing leaks, or dense mulch against the foundation need closer attention than homes with dry, open, well-maintained perimeters. Local termite species and building practices also affect the right treatment approach.

Know the warning signs before damage spreads

Do not rely on seeing live termites. They avoid light and exposure, so evidence is often indirect. A single sign does not always confirm an infestation, but it is a reason to inspect more closely or call a licensed pest professional.

  • Mud tubes: Pencil-width to larger earthen shelter tubes on foundation walls, piers, plumbing penetrations, crawl-space surfaces, or interior framing can indicate subterranean termite travel.
  • Swarmers or discarded wings: Winged reproductive termites may emerge indoors or near the home. Their shed wings are usually similar in size and shape. Swarms indicate a nearby mature colony, though not necessarily active feeding in that exact room.
  • Damaged or hollow-sounding wood: Blistering paint, buckling trim, soft flooring, sagging sections, or wood that sounds hollow when tapped deserves investigation.
  • Small pellets: Drywood termites may push hard, grain-like fecal pellets from tiny openings in infested wood. These can collect below window frames, baseboards, furniture, or exposed beams.
  • Persistent moisture: Moisture is not proof of termites, but leaks, standing water, and damp crawl spaces increase conditions that support termite activity and wood decay.

Flying ants are frequently mistaken for termite swarmers. Ants usually have a narrow, pinched waist, elbowed antennae, and front wings longer than rear wings. Termites have a thicker waist, straighter antennae, and wings of roughly equal length. If you can safely collect a sample without disturbing the area, it may help a professional identify it correctly.

Reduce the conditions that attract termites

Prevention cannot guarantee that termites will never reach a home, particularly in areas where termite pressure is high. It can, however, remove common food, moisture, and access conditions that make undetected activity more likely. Start outside and work toward the structure.

Control water around the foundation

Water management is among the most useful parts of termite protection. Clean gutters and downspouts so roof runoff moves away from the foundation. Repair leaking outdoor spigots, irrigation lines, roof flashing, and plumbing. If water regularly pools beside the home, investigate grading, drainage, or hardscape issues rather than repeatedly treating the symptom.

Crawl spaces deserve particular attention. Standing water, wet soil, condensation on pipes, and damp insulation should be addressed promptly. The correct fix may involve plumbing repair, drainage work, ventilation changes, vapor control, or a combination of measures depending on the building and climate.

Remove wood-to-soil contact

Termites can move directly from soil into untreated wood that touches the ground. Keep firewood, lumber, old landscape timbers, cardboard, tree stumps, and wood debris away from the structure. A firewood stack belongs off the ground and away from the exterior wall, not under a deck or against the garage.

Check fences, trellises, steps, planter borders, and deck components. These features do not automatically create a termite problem, but buried or soil-contact wood can form an easy bridge to the house. Replace decayed elements and avoid placing new wood where it covers foundation surfaces or touches soil unless it is designed and installed for that use.

Keep inspection zones visible

Exterior finishes should not conceal the foundation-to-wall transition. Thick mulch, soil, stored materials, and dense plant growth can hide mud tubes and reduce access for inspections. Keep mulch and soil below siding, trim, and weep openings where applicable, and avoid piling it against exterior walls.

Do not seal every crack blindly as a substitute for termite control. Closing obvious gaps around utility lines and damaged trim can reduce entry opportunities, but subterranean termites can exploit concealed routes and tiny openings. Exclusion supports a broader termite protection plan; it does not replace monitoring or treatment.

A seasonal termite protection checklist

Regular checks are more useful than a rushed inspection only after a swarm or visible damage. Use this checklist at least periodically and after events such as a plumbing leak, flood, roof leak, or major landscaping work.

  1. Walk the exterior perimeter. Look for mud tubes, damaged wood, soil or mulch piled against siding, and areas where a deck, fence, or stored material touches the home.
  2. Check drainage. Confirm that gutters are clear, downspouts discharge away from the foundation, and irrigation is not soaking the wall or crawl-space area.
  3. Inspect accessible wood. Examine porch posts, door frames, deck supports, window trim, garage framing, and exposed crawl-space timbers for softness, blistering, or unexplained holes.
  4. Look in quiet interior areas. Pay attention to baseboards, window sills, closets, utility rooms, unfinished spaces, and locations near plumbing fixtures.
  5. Remove conducive materials. Move cardboard, scrap lumber, firewood, and wood debris away from the building.
  6. Record what you find. Photograph tubes, wings, pellets, stains, or damaged surfaces before cleaning or repairing them. Documentation helps a professional assess the situation.
  7. Schedule an inspection when needed. Do not wait for severe visible damage if evidence is present or the home has a history of termite activity.

Termite protection options: prevention, monitoring, and treatment

The right option depends on whether termites are only a risk or are already active. A homeowner with no evidence of termites may focus on maintenance and periodic professional inspections. A home with confirmed activity needs a treatment plan designed around the location and type of infestation.

Approach Best suited to Main advantage Limitation What to verify
Moisture and wood-contact correction All homes, especially where conditions are favorable Addresses conditions that support termites and wood decay Does not eliminate an established colony That leaks, drainage issues, and soil-contact wood are actually corrected
Professional termite inspection Homes with warning signs, prior activity, or a pending sale Helps identify evidence, entry routes, and inaccessible risk areas May not reveal every concealed infestation Inspector licensing requirements and the scope of the inspection report
Bait system Long-term monitoring and colony-control programs Can provide ongoing observation at stations around the property Requires correct placement, regular servicing, and patience Service interval, monitoring responsibilities, and warranty terms
Liquid soil treatment Subterranean termite activity or a targeted protective barrier Can treat soil around structural entry areas Application may require trenching, drilling, or access to specific areas Where treatment will be applied and how construction features affect coverage
Localized wood treatment Accessible, limited drywood termite activity Targets known areas with less disruption than whole-structure work Can miss separate hidden infestations How the provider determined the infestation is limited
Whole-structure treatment Widespread or difficult-to-locate drywood termite infestation Addresses termite activity throughout the structure Requires planning, preparation, and temporary vacancy Preparation instructions, treatment scope, re-entry process, and warranty

For subterranean termites, liquid treatments and bait systems are common professional approaches. A liquid treatment is generally focused on soil where termites travel between the ground and the building. Bait systems are installed and maintained around the property, with the goal of intercepting foraging termites and delivering a colony-control product through their feeding activity. Neither option should be chosen solely because it sounds less disruptive; site conditions determine whether it is suitable.

For drywood termites, a provider may recommend localized treatment when evidence is clearly confined to a small, accessible area. When activity is widespread, located in several areas, or difficult to map, whole-structure treatment may be considered. Ask why the proposed scope fits the evidence. A lower-disruption treatment is not necessarily the better value if it leaves other infested areas untreated.

When DIY termite control is useful—and when it is not

DIY work has a real role in termite protection, mainly through moisture repair, removing wood debris, improving inspection access, and watching for signs of activity. These tasks reduce risk and make professional inspections more effective. Homeowners can also repair minor exterior conditions once the termite issue has been evaluated.

DIY insecticides are less dependable for confirmed termite infestations. Surface sprays may kill exposed insects while leaving the colony, hidden galleries, and soil-based access routes untouched. Injecting a product into one visible hole can create a false sense of security, particularly with subterranean termites that may be feeding from multiple concealed points.

Choose professional help promptly if you find mud tubes, termite swarmers indoors, drywood pellets that reappear after cleaning, visible structural damage, or activity around a foundation or crawl space. Professional assessment is also sensible before closing walls, replacing damaged framing, or making a major repair. Repairing over active termites can hide evidence and make later treatment more difficult.

How to choose a termite protection provider

A termite proposal should be specific enough for you to understand what will happen to your home. Be cautious with vague promises of “complete protection” that do not identify the termite species, treatment areas, service schedule, or exclusions. Local licensing and treatment rules vary, so confirm that the provider is properly licensed for termite work in your area.

  • Request a written inspection report or diagram showing evidence and affected areas.
  • Ask whether the recommendation addresses subterranean termites, drywood termites, or another wood-destroying pest.
  • Find out whether inaccessible areas, attached structures, crawl spaces, slabs, or interior walls limit treatment coverage.
  • Read the warranty carefully. A retreatment warranty and a repair warranty are not the same thing.
  • Ask who will perform future inspections or bait-station service and what happens if the property changes ownership.
  • Compare more than one inspection when the recommendation involves extensive drilling, fumigation, or major expense.

Do not assume a home warranty, homeowners insurance policy, or prior treatment contract automatically pays for termite damage. Coverage and exclusions differ. Review the documents you actually hold, especially if the property has a previous termite history or you are buying or selling the home.

Common mistakes that weaken termite protection

Waiting for obvious structural failure

Termite damage can remain hidden for a long time. A door that suddenly sticks, a sagging floor, or a crumbling baseboard may be a late sign rather than the beginning of the problem. Investigate earlier clues such as wings, tubes, pellets, moisture, and hollow wood.

Covering the evidence

Painting over damaged trim, filling holes, or removing mud tubes before documenting them can make diagnosis harder. Photograph the area first. A professional may need to inspect the surrounding materials to determine whether activity is current and where termites entered.

Treating landscaping as separate from home maintenance

Overwatered beds, mulch against siding, buried wood, and grade changes near the foundation can affect termite risk. Landscaping choices should preserve drainage and leave exterior inspection areas accessible.

Choosing solely on the lowest quote

Two estimates may cover very different work. One might include a full inspection, treatment of defined areas, scheduled monitoring, and a clear warranty; another may cover a narrow application with limited follow-up. Compare methods, access limitations, and contract terms before deciding.

Frequently Asked Questions

Can termite protection prevent every infestation?

No method can promise that termites will never approach a property. Termite protection lowers risk by reducing favorable conditions, providing inspection access, and using appropriate professional monitoring or treatment where needed. Ongoing maintenance matters because drainage, landscaping, and building conditions change over time.

How often should a home be inspected for termites?

The appropriate interval depends on local termite pressure, the home’s construction, previous activity, and the terms of any service agreement. An inspection is especially sensible when you notice warning signs, after significant moisture problems, and during a property transaction. A local licensed termite professional can recommend an interval for the specific property.

Are mud tubes always a sign of active termites?

Mud tubes are strongly associated with subterranean termites, but an old tube may remain after activity has stopped or after prior treatment. Do not assume a broken tube means the problem is gone. A professional can assess nearby materials and conditions for current activity.

Can mulch cause termites?

Mulch does not create termites, but heavy or constantly damp mulch against the foundation can retain moisture and hide termite evidence. Keep it from covering siding, trim, vents, or visible foundation areas. Use mulch in a way that supports drainage and allows routine inspection.

Is it safe to repair termite-damaged wood before treatment?

Minor emergency stabilization may sometimes be necessary, but permanent repairs should generally follow a proper termite assessment. Replacing wood without addressing active termites can conceal galleries and leave the source of the problem untouched. Discuss the repair sequence with the pest professional and, where structural damage is involved, a qualified building professional.

Make termite protection part of regular home care

The most practical next step is to inspect the areas you can see: foundation edges, crawl spaces, exterior wood, drainage points, and places where soil or stored materials meet the house. Correct moisture and wood-contact problems, preserve clear inspection access, and document anything suspicious. If you find termite evidence or unexplained wood damage, arrange a professional inspection before attempting repairs. Consistent termite protection is far less disruptive than discovering the problem after hidden damage has spread.
